With the training and certifications to work in almost any environment, our operators have the experience and knowledge to safely execute any project they undertake.
4218 43 StreetCamrose, Alberta T4V 5H4
Email: info@necltd.ca Phone: 780-679-7825 Fax: 780-672-8523
About UsSafetyCompleted ProjectsServicesCareersContact
Made with